NGC 13 - galaxy in the constellation Andromedae
Type: Sab -
The angular dimensions: 2.30'x0.6'
magnitude: V=13.2m; B=14.0m
The surface brightness: 13.5 mag/arcmin2
Coordinates for epoch J2000: Ra= 0h8m47.7s; Dec= 33°25'59"
redshift (z): 0.016038
The distance from the Sun to NGC 13: based on the amount of redshift (z) - 67.7 Mpc;
Other names of the object NGC 13 : PGC 650, UGC 77, MCG 5-1-34, CGCG 498-81, CGCG 499-53
